first off, the A/V looked fantastic. and zero noticeable A/V cuts/changes.
i thought the studio's Flight was incredibly boring and not be honest i fell asleep halfway through and have never revisited it.
which is why i was kindof excited to see Liquid because i wanted to see if i would enjoy it any more.
short answer . . yes.
gone is the confusing and distracting story of the girl that i didn't care much for to begin with. we focus on a talented and troubled pilot and because of that (and probably the shorter run time) i was able to make it to the end completely awake. i originally had the story as a 9, but then i considered what was removed and how the story was still on par.
i rate the studio movie really low (below five easily) so my enjoyment really jumped with Gatos' version here.
i was hoping for a special feature with the girl or maybe something at the end of the credits showing Whip's prison time. the transition in music at the very end for the credits was a little harsh too. but those two things are only personal preferences.
good on you, Gatos. you successfully fumigated a stinker.

The original FLIGHT was a movie I found to be pretty much instantly forgettable upon exiting the theatre, which really shocked me considering it's pedigree. Yes, Denzel Washington is riveting when on the screen, and Zemeckis performed some pretty cool visuals, but otherwise this story felt like it a Lifetime TV Movie of the Week, not a major motion picture.

Thus, I was very curious what Gatos could redeem from this story. But to be honest, I did not trust myself to be unbiased when reviewing, so I pulled the old switcharoo on my beloved wife, and did not tell her we were watching a Fan Edit.

Well, she really liked it. She said it packed a very strong emotional punch and that it felt very believable. The new ending she thought felt a bit jarring for her, but she said that is how real life is. Myself, I agree, this version is much stronger emotionally but I still had difficulty buying into it.

Technically, this is superior editing. Excellent video. Great audio. Perfect cuts.

Gatos has taken what I consider to be a mediocre movie and made it very, very good.
Still not great, but a tremendous improvement and should definitely be watched to appreciate Gatos fine skill at sculpting a more dramatic narrative.

Thumbs Up.

This was a very well done edit, it trimmed a lot of the fat and gave the movie a much better pacing. The ending is better than the original, but still leaves something to be desired. But this is no fault to Gatos as he chose the best place you could end the movie. But in the end I still end up asking myself what is the point of the movie. It just seemed pointless and phoned in. But once again this is not the editor's fault. He turned a movie i would rate as a 6 into a solid 8. So much kudos to you sir. There were only 2 places i could tell something was removed but still not jarring or distracting.

Good work sir
